Pursuing the Future of Electric Mobility

In a decisive move, Honda, one of Japan’s automotive giants, has joined forces with the Californian startup QuantumScape. This partnership marks an intensified effort to break new ground in the field of advanced battery technology—specifically, to bring the long-anticipated promise of solid-state batteries closer to reality for mass-market electric vehicles.

A Calculated Response to Past Challenges

The alliance comes after Honda faced disappointing results with several recent electric models in North America. Seeking to regain momentum and credibility in a fiercely competitive sector, the automaker is turning to technological innovation as its strategy. The collaboration with QuantumScape, renowned for its breakthroughs in solid-state battery research, represents both a response to these setbacks and a commitment to future growth.

The Race for Solid-State Batteries

Solid-state batteries are widely seen as a potential game-changer for the electric vehicle industry. Unlike conventional lithium-ion cells, these advanced units promise:

  • Greater energy density, enabling longer driving ranges
  • Faster charging times that could rival traditional refueling stops
  • Enhanced safety due to reduced fire risks and increased durability

It’s little wonder, then, that global manufacturers are scrambling for a technological edge. For Honda, placing its bets on this emerging technology could decisively shape its future competitiveness.
